About John Taylor

John Taylor is a seasoned leader, strategist, and visionary thinker with over 40 years’ experience in business development, intellectual property management / licensing, game design (Online, PC and Casino), gaming compliance, engineering design, software / hardware development, team building and C-level company operations.Prior to Serqit, John held senior executive positions at Video Gaming Technologies (VGT), News Corp, Electronic Arts (EA), and GE. He is a founder of four other companies in addition to SerQit, including Kesmai—the first commercial online gaming company in the world. Other career highlights include:* Honored with the 2011 Online Game Legend Award by the Online Game Developers Conference, which recognizes the career and achievements of an individual who has made an impact on the craft of online game development.* Established a performance-based engineering department at VGT, starting with two people and growing to 265 with an annual budget of $36MM. VGT was named on INC 500’s list of fastest growing small companies in 2005.* Oversaw the design and development of numerous popular electronic and online game titles, including “Island of Kesmai,” "Godzilla Online," "Starship Troopers," "Aliens Online," "MultiPlayer BattleTech," and “Air Warrior,” a first-of-its kind, multiplayer flight simulation game with a graphical interface. * Designed and developed the original Aries online game platform, the third generation of which powers EA’s Sims Online—and Omega, a massively multi-player (MMO) online gaming platform that is currently being used in multiple industries. Over the course of his career, John has acquired a vast toolbox of competencies that include assembling and guiding high-performing creative teams, innovative game design, strategic planning, contract negotiation, gaming compliance, financial modeling, and developing and managing intellectual property for gaming systems.

  • Kesmai Corporation ( A Division Of News Corporation)
    President
    Kesmai Corporation ( A Division Of News Corporation) Apr 1994 - Feb 2000
    New York, New York, Us
    As President of Kesmai, John provided vital leadership as the company grew into the leading developer and publisher of online games, with a staff of over 85 people and 20 online titles. He was tasked with negotiating publishing and distribution agreements with America Online, Prodigy, Earthlink, CompuServe, British Telecom, Sega (“Heat.net”), Engage, and GameSpot. He also negotiated intellectual property rights for titles such as “Godzilla Online” (Centropolis/Sony), “Starship Troopers” (Hilltop/Sony) and “Aliens Online” (Fox).John’s role at Kesmai included serving on the News Technology Committee, where he was responsible for defining high-tech strategy for and cooperation among the various divisions of News Corporation (such as 20th Century Fox, B Sky B, Times of London, etc). Additionally, he worked with News Data Systems in Israel to design its business strategy for satellite delivery of set-top gaming. John also established business strategies and oversaw technical operations for Kesmai’s “GameStorm,” a pay-for-play, web-based gaming service.
  • Kesmai Corporation
    Ceo / Founder
    Kesmai Corporation 1982 - 1994
    Charlottesville, Virginia, Us
    As a co-founder of Kesmai Corporation—the first commercial online game company in the world—John began the commercialization of his work in multiplayer gaming, which he started while still in graduate school. At Kesmai, he pioneered the design of text-based MUDs and role-playing games such as Kesmai’s “MegaWars III,” “Stellar Emperor,” “Stellar Warrior,” and “Island of Kesmai.” He also developed “Air Warrior,” a first-of-its kind, multiplayer flight simulation game with a graphical interface. While at Kesmai, John also designed and developed the original ARIES online game platform, the third generation of which powers EA’s Sims Online.One of John’s achievements at Kesmai was expanding the business into the publishing of third-party online games via distribution agreements with U.S., Japanese, and European online providers. He also negotiated the sale of Kesmai Corporation to Rupert Murdoch’s News Corporation.
